Read More →David Westcott was elected the 2012 National Automobile Dealers Association vice chairman. The North Carolina dealer will take office at the 2012 NADA-ATD Convention and Expo.
Read More →The North American Dealer Co-Op (NADC), which came to the aid of automotive dealers when another guaranteed refund program folded over the summer, is now in danger of losing its own 17-year-old program.
